The Suns fear that Jalen Green could miss multiple games after aggravating his right hamstring strain in Saturday’s win over the Clippers, according to Duane Rankin of The Arizona Republic. Green felt a sharp pain after passing the ball to Ryan Dunn for a corner three-point shot late in the first quarter, Rankin writes. Brooks Questionable Saturday; Green Has Impressive Debut
Suns forward Dillon Brooks is questionable for Saturday’s rematch against the Clippers in Los Angeles, tweets Law Murray of The Athletic. Brooks has missed the past six games with a core muscle strain. Bradley Beal Criticizes Usage With Suns In Return To Phoenix
After getting a hostile reception from Phoenix fans Thursday night, Clippers guard Bradley Beal indicated that he doesn’t have fond memories of his two years with the Suns, writes Law Murray of The Athletic. Beal was booed during pre-game introductions and again each time he touched the ball during a 13-point loss. Jalen Green Probable To Make Suns Debut Thursday
Suns guard Jalen Green has been upgraded to probable for Thursday’s matchup against the Clippers, according to Duane Rankin of The Arizona Republic (Twitter link). If he is able to suit up, it would mark both Green’s season and Suns debut. Devin Booker Wants To Finish Career With Suns
The Suns are no longer considered a serious contender in the Western Conference following their failed big three experiment with Kevin Durant and Bradley Beal joining forces with Devin Booker. Durant and Beal are now playing for the Rockets and Clippers, respectively.
